Etymology

[edit]

    Borrowed from Spanish Madrid.

    Pronunciation

    [edit]
    • IPA(key): /ˈma.drɘt/
    • Audio:(file)
    • Rhymes: -adrɘt
    • Syllabification: Ma‧dryt

    Proper noun

    [edit]

    Madryt m

    1. Madrid (the capital city of Spain)
    2. Madrid, Community of Madrid (an autonomous community of Spain)
    3. Madrid (a province of the Community of Madrid, Spain)
